EROSION UNIT STANDARD - 252457
Soil Erosion is the removal of top soil through actions like weather conditions like rain,snow or wind,then you also get other natural causes like animals.Erosion is also caused by us humans.
you also get 7 different types of erosion namely 
  1. sheet 
  2. rill
  3. gully
  4. overland flow
  5. abrasion
  6. corrosion
  7. hydrolic action .
Erosion can be controlled by doing the following or using the following ways
Branching: Place branches on the area where you want to protect it from animals crossing or eating it.
Active seedling: Seeds from a fast growing indigenous grass can be planted. Their growth points are very close to ground level and they often form stolons and or rhizomes which are good at stabilizing the soil. 
Windbreaks: Natural windbreaks can be planted using indigenous trees and shrubs in areas where erosion by wind is a main factor.

the types of vegetables cut you get
  1. Julienne - Thin matchstick size cuts 1-2 mm thick and 3 cm long 
  2. Macedoine - thick diced veggies mm thick (cubes)
  3. batonnet - matchstick size but thicker than the julienne for example chips 
  4. brunoise - small fine vegetable cuts 3mm x 3mm 
  5. chiffonade - finely sliced or chopped for example herbs 
  6. Mirepois - rough cut vegetables example carrots ,onions ,cut into mostly squares often used in stock 
Some of the cooking methods
  1. Blanching 
  2. poaching - gentle cooking process done in water 
  3. boiling - cooking of food in rapid boiling water 
  4. steaming - cooking of food in hot moist air .also reduce cooking time 
  5. frying - quick frying of food with oil ,medium to high heat 
  6. roasting - cooking of large joints in dry heat (150 - 175 c )
  7. grilling - fast cooking of small tender pieces with little or no oil (220 -250 )done by contact heat 
  8. gratinating -food prepared au gratin has a high fat content and is browned on the surface eg : lasagne ,done under a salamander with dry air 
  9. baking - cooking of food in dry heat moistened by its ingredients 
  10. sauteing - quick frying of food in a pan with little oil 
  11. stewing - moist cooking methods for tough meats ,cut into small pieces
  12. braising - combination of roasting ans stewing in a brisiere on a stove or oven 
  13. Glaceing - same application as braising but used for a white meat only ,done in fat then liquid,                Basting - contains acid  , Glacing - contains sugar 
  14. Pot roasting - cooking of poultry in fat medium pot

when feeding the LIONS you have to do the following -
  • 2 persons must go to feed them then ,one locks the lions to the side while the other one quickly go in then right after the one enter the other one enter 
  • then when inside the cage do not give the wrong food to the wrong lion ( MAX - gets  bigger pieces than LEX because he eats quicker than she does )
  • lock the lion away from each other by calling their names ,one to the right and one to the left (LEX - left and MAX - right ) 
  • give the food at the same time other wise they will fight over the food or one bowl
  • when they are done take the bowls away other wise they will bite and play with them..

We used a wire puller to pull the fence closer to each other and then by using a gripple we connected the wire to each other ..we also used a 90 degree method which is where you take a wire puller and pull the wire closer then take the broken wire and just place a new wire next to it .by then holding it with  pliers and turning the two points in a 90 degree direction one point upwards and the other one downwards. after this is done you take the wire puller off and the fence would be tight enough and strong enough again..
